xLogicCircuits
xLogicCircuits is a basic visual logic circuit drawing tool and ON/OFF state tester. As its name implies, xLogicCircuits does not account for resistors, voltage or amperage of an electrical circuit, but rather only accounts for logic gates,...
xModels 2D and 3D
xModels-2D and xModels-3D are geometric modeling programs, designed to illustrate the basics ideas of geometric transformations, hierarchical computer graphics modeling, and animation. Images are described in a "scene description...

xFunctions
xFunctions is a general-purpose program for playing with mathematical functions. It is not meant for use in scientific analysis or for making presentation-type graphs and charts. It was written primarily to help students learn...

xSortLab
xSortLab is a program for learning about and experimenting with five sorting algorithms: bubble sort, selection sort, insertion sort, merge sort and quicksort. The program has two modes of operation, visual and timed. In visual...
